Output 84e7195dacc41306dfaf1648919d8bf6456249319dd60ad204ca52d54e240635:0

value
1972397135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0947a07c32ac5ec9ed27d028b67cf0a60669df OP_EQUAL
address
AFgn65TvxyWMmuPCVdRwyYJAgVL1Dk3DjA
transaction
84e7195dacc41306dfaf1648919d8bf6456249319dd60ad204ca52d54e240635